Solar panels produce less than expected

Low production may be normal in certain conditions, but it can also indicate a panel, string, inverter or monitoring issue.

Possible causes

  • partial shading on panels
  • dirty or covered panels
  • disconnected string or tripped DC protection
  • grid limitation or inverter setting
  • unfavorable orientation/tilt
